(1.8 Miles from Carlsbad, CA)
TASSAJARA DESIGNS INC
2719 Loker Ave W, Carlsbad, CA (1.8 Miles from Carlsbad, CA)
  • Time in business: 17 years years
  • Licensed

(3.1 Miles from Vista, CA)
Pull Out Shelf Co.
2332 Mira Sol Drive, Vista, CA (3.1 Miles from Vista, CA)